Architecture Highlights Tour
Discover how a small midwestern city became a modern architecture destination. Be introduced to architects like I.M. Pei, Robert Venturi, Eliel and Eero Saarinen, Harry Weese, and Deborah Berke. And see how their architectural genius is showcased throughout the city.
This guided tour explores dozens of locations and includes a close-up look at two sites. Whether you’re an architecture expert or are just curious about design, this tour is a perfect introduction to Columbus.
